This is a seriously divisive cheapie that evokes strong reactions. For some, it's a creamy, musky, powdery dream. For others, it's a synthetic mess, or merely glorified baby wipes or Nivea cream. Don't blind buy unless you're a devoted fan of sweet, powdery musks - and even then, prepare for a potential surprise.
This isn't just another rose perfume; it's a soft, elegant, and understated take on the classic. While it splits opinion with some finding a surprising tobacco note or fleeting longevity, the consensus celebrates its delicate charm and natural beauty. A true shame it was discontinued, but it remains a cherished gem.

Occasions
Its soft-to-medium projection and creamy, comforting profile make it excellent for casual wear or intimate dates where you want to be noticed without overwhelming. While some find it suitable for work due to its 'clean' aspect, the prominent sweetness and powder might be too much for formal settings or sports.

Occasions
Its musky-rose core, complemented by vanilla and amber, offers a subtle and 'close to skin' sillage, making it ideal for office wear and casual settings, as noted by many reviewers. The delicate nature and perceived poor longevity make it less suitable for high-impact formal events or sport.
